Abstract

The utility model discloses a peritoneal dialysis catheter connecting clamp; comprises a movable handle and two semicircular clamping plates which are oppositely fixed at the front ends of the two movable handles; two clamping parts A are oppositely arranged on the inner surfaces of the two semicircular clamping plates; the two clamping parts A are respectively provided with a semicircular clamping arc A, and the middle parts of the semicircular clamping arcs A are respectively provided with clamping grooves suitable for clamping the clamping lugs on the circular connecting parts A of the corresponding peritoneal dialysis catheter; when the two movable handles are operated to enable the two semicircular clamping plates to oppositely clamp the peritoneal dialysis catheter, the semicircular clamping arcs A of the two clamping parts A tightly wrap the circular connecting part A of the peritoneal dialysis catheter relatively. Has the advantages that: the utility model discloses when centre gripping peritoneal dialysis pipe, the centre gripping steadiness is good for can not the centre gripping skid, the circular connecting portion A of peritoneal dialysis pipe and the last ear of grabbing of it are difficult because of the utility model discloses the centre gripping is skidded and is received wearing and tearing, makes corresponding peritoneal dialysis pipe long service life.

Background
Peritoneal Dialysis (PD) is a type of dialysis that uses the peritoneum of the human body itself as a dialysis membrane. The dialysate filled into the abdominal cavity exchanges solute and moisture with the plasma components in the capillary vessel on the other side of the peritoneal cavity, thereby removing the metabolites and excessive moisture retained in the body, and simultaneously supplementing the substances necessary for the body through the dialysate. The aim of kidney substitution or supporting treatment is achieved by continuously updating the peritoneal dialysis solution.
In the existing hospitals, when the peritoneal dialysis is performed on a patient, the patient needs to establish a passage to perform the dialysis, and the passage consists of two parts, namely a permanently-retained peritoneal dialysis tube and a peritoneal dialysis external short tube which are connected in sequence. In the process of peritoneal dialysis, a patient needs to replace peritoneal dialysis solution three to five times every day, so the most easily damaged parts with the highest use frequency are the connection part of the external short pipe end of the peritoneal dialysis and the connection part of the peritoneal dialysis pipe end;
the existing peritoneal dialysis catheter generally comprises an internal thread connecting port, a circular connecting part A, a circular connecting part B, a conical table-shaped connecting part and a dialysis catheter body which are sequentially connected from front to back; the outer diameter of the internal thread connecting port is equal to the outer diameter of the circular connecting part B and is larger than the outer diameter of the circular connecting part A; the front end of the conical frustum-shaped connecting part is in smooth transition with the rear end of the circular connecting part B; two grabbing lugs integrally formed with the circular connecting part A are fixedly arranged on the outer wall of the circular connecting part A in an opposite mode;
for the peritoneal dialysis tube, during operation, a clamping forceps is generally required to be clamped outside the circular connecting part A to screw the peritoneal dialysis tube to be in threaded connection with the end of the corresponding peritoneal dialysis external short pipe, while the traditional clamping forceps are ordinary forceps bodies, the structure of the traditional clamping forceps is similar to that of a common vice, and although the traditional clamping forceps are widely used, the traditional clamping forceps still have certain defects and shortcomings;
particularly, on the one hand, the two opposite clamping surfaces can only clamp the outer lug of the corresponding circular connecting part A generally, so that the clamping stability is not good, the clamping is easy to slip, and on the other hand, the corresponding circular connecting part A and the outer surfaces of the two corresponding lugs on the outer part of the corresponding circular connecting part A are easy to wear when the clamping slips, so that the corresponding peritoneal dialysis catheter is easy to damage and the service life is short.
Thereby, the existing problems remain to be solved.

Detailed Description
The technical solutions of the present invention will be described in detail below with reference to the accompanying drawings and specific embodiments, so as to clearly and intuitively understand the inventive substance of the present invention.
As shown in fig. 1, 2 and 3;
the utility model provides a peritoneal dialysis catheter connecting clamp 1000 which is used for clamping a peritoneal dialysis catheter 2000; the peritoneal dialysis catheter 2000 comprises an internal thread connecting port 201, a circular connecting part A202, a circular connecting part B203, a conical table-shaped connecting part 204 and a dialysis catheter body 205 which are sequentially connected from front to back; the external diameter of the internal thread connecting port 201 is equal to that of the circular connecting part B203 and is larger than that of the circular connecting part A202; the front end of the conical frustum-shaped connecting part 204 is in smooth transition with the rear end of the circular connecting part B203; two lugs 2021 which are integrally formed with the circular connecting part A202 are fixedly arranged opposite to the outer wall of the circular connecting part A; the part of the internal thread connecting port 201 connected with the circular connecting part A202 is formed into a step surface A, and the part of the circular connecting part A202 connected with the circular connecting part B203 is formed into a step surface B2022;
the utility model discloses an improvement lies in: comprises two movable handles 102 hinged with each other through a rotating shaft part 101 to form a cross structure and two semicircular clamping plates 103 which are oppositely and fixedly arranged at the front ends of the two movable handles 102;
wherein, two clamping parts A1031 suitable for clamping the circular connecting part A202 are oppositely arranged on the inner surfaces of the two semicircular clamping plates 103; the two clamping parts A1031 are respectively provided with a semicircular clamping arc A, the middle parts of the two semicircular clamping arcs A are respectively provided with a clamping groove 10311 suitable for the corresponding clamping lug 2021 to clamp, and the width of the two semicircular clamping arcs A is equal to or less than that of the circular connecting part A202;
when the two movable handles 102 are operated to clamp the peritoneal dialysis catheter 2000 with the two semicircular clamping plates 103 facing each other, the semicircular clamping arcs a of the two clamping parts a1031 tightly wrap the circular connecting part a202 of the peritoneal dialysis catheter 2000.
From top to bottom, can know, the utility model discloses when centre gripping peritoneal dialysis pipe 2000, the centre gripping steadiness is good for can not the centre gripping skid.
And, the utility model discloses under the prerequisite that can not the centre gripping skid, also make peritoneal dialysis pipe 2000's circular connecting portion A202 and last ear 2021 of grabbing difficult because of the utility model discloses the centre gripping is skidded and is received wearing and tearing for corresponding peritoneal dialysis pipe 2000 long service life.
Therefore, the utility model discloses the practicality is strong, excellent in use effect.
Further, in the present technical solution, a protection pad 10312 made of hard plastic material is respectively adhered to the surfaces of the semicircular clamping arc a of the two clamping portions a1031 and the corresponding clamping groove 10311, and friction-resistant lines 10313 are respectively arranged on the surfaces of the two protection pads 10312.
In this way, when the circular connection portion a202 of the peritoneal dialysis tube 2000 and the gripping lugs 2021 thereon are clamped in an opposite direction, the clamping stability of the clamping portions a1031 is better, and the circular connection portion a202 of the peritoneal dialysis tube 2000 and the gripping lugs 2021 thereon are less prone to wear.
In practical implementation, the semicircular clamping arcs of the two clamping portions a1031 are correspondingly arranged on one side of the inner surfaces of the two semicircular clamping plates 103;
two clamping parts B1032 suitable for clamping the circular connecting part B203 are oppositely arranged on the other side of the inner surfaces of the two semicircular clamping plates 103; the two clamping parts B1032 are respectively provided with a semicircular clamping arc B, and the two clamping parts B1032 are correspondingly connected with the two clamping parts A1031;
when the two movable handles 102 are operated to clamp the peritoneal dialysis catheter 2000 with the two semicircular clamping plates 103 facing each other, the semicircular clamping arcs B of the two clamping parts B1032 tightly wrap the circular connecting part B203 of the peritoneal dialysis catheter 2000.
Two clamping parts B1032 suitable for clamping the circular connecting part B203 are oppositely arranged on the other sides of the inner surfaces of the two semicircular clamping plates 103; the two clamping parts B1032 are respectively provided with a semicircular clamping arc B, and the two clamping parts B1032 are correspondingly connected with the two clamping parts A1031;
thus, when the two movable handles 102 are operated to clamp the peritoneal dialysis catheter 2000 with the two semicircular clamping plates 103 facing each other, the semicircular clamping arcs B of the two clamping parts B1032 can relatively tightly wrap the circular connecting part B203 of the peritoneal dialysis catheter 2000, so that the utility model will not slide back and forth along the length direction of the peritoneal dialysis catheter 2000 when clamping the peritoneal dialysis catheter 2000, specifically, one surface of the two clamping parts A1031 deviating from the corresponding position of the circular connecting part B203 is formed as a limiting surface A10314, and is abutted to the step surface A of the corresponding peritoneal dialysis catheter 2000, one surface of the two clamping parts A1031 facing to the corresponding position of the circular connecting part B203 is formed into a limiting surface B, and paste to corresponding peritoneal dialysis pipe 2000's step face B2022 for can keep off and establish double-phase corresponding clamping part A1031 along corresponding circular connecting portion A202 back-and-forth movement, from this, even get the utility model discloses a centre gripping steadiness and centre gripping reliability can reach the best.
In addition, in practical implementation, the utility model further includes two finger rings 104, which are oppositely and fixedly arranged at the rear ends of the two movable handles 102 and are suitable for holding.
So, medical personnel are holding the utility model discloses the time, two corresponding rings 104 are buckled into to its finger, even must be convenient for take and hold between the fingers the utility model discloses, make the utility model discloses be difficult for taking off one's hand.
In the present technical solution, a sub-buckle body 105 facing to another ring 104 is fixedly arranged on one of the rings 104, and a female buckle body 106 opposite to the sub-buckle body 105 and staggered up and down is fixedly arranged on the other ring 104;
in a preferred embodiment, a concave pit 1051 is recessed downwards in the middle of the upper end surface of the sub-buckle body 105; a convex block 1061 which is integrally formed with the female buckle body 106 and is suitable for being clamped into the concave pit 1051 is arranged at the middle part of the lower bottom surface of the female buckle body 106 in a downward protruding manner;
when the protrusion 1061 is engaged with the recess 1051, so that the male buckle body 105 is fastened to the female buckle body 106, the two semicircular clamping plates 103 clamp the peritoneal dialysis catheter 2000 in opposite directions.
Therefore, the body 105 is detained to the son with when the body 106 looks lock joint is detained to the mother, even if in two semi-circular grip block 103 keeps pressing from both sides tightly for the clamping state peritoneal dialysis catheter 2000, makes the utility model discloses difficult pine takes off to make and save medical personnel and use the power to pinch tightly always the utility model discloses a trouble makes the utility model discloses easy operation.
It is further necessary to supplement that, in the specific implementation, the two movable handles 102, the two semicircular clamping plates 103, the two finger rings 104, the male buckle body 105 and the female buckle body 106 are made of stainless steel, so that the utility model is sturdy and durable, and is convenient for cleaning, cleaning and disinfecting.
It is further to be added that, in the implementation, the surfaces of the two movable handles 102 and the two semicircular clamping plates 103 are respectively coated with an iodophor coating for sterilization.
Therefore, when the utility model is used, the coating iodophor coating can play a certain disinfection role and can effectively resist and kill germs, so that the two movable handles 102 and the two semicircular clamping plates 103 have good safety when contacting the peritoneal dialysis tube 2000 and are not easy to pollute the peritoneal dialysis tube 2000.
